Ectopic expression of ppk28 confers water sensitivity. a. Extracellular bristle recordings of i-type sensilla (non-water responsive) from Gr66a-Gal4 flies lacking (-) or containing (+) UAS-ppk28 upon water, 0.5M NMDG, 1M NMDG or 0.01M caffeine stimulation (at recording). b. Scatter plot of water responses (mean ± s.e.m in bars; data points are dots) and summary of all responses (mean ± s.e.m.). Responses are different to water (***P=2.52E-16) and 0.5M NMDG (*P=0.016) (t-test; n=7-27). c. G-CaMP fluorescence increase in Gr66a bitter-sensing projections (left) and Gr66a projections expressing ppk28 (right), after water stimulation (%maxΔF/F) (SOG, scale 50μm). d. Responses in Gr66a cells (left) and Gr66a cells expressing ppk28 (right) to water (at arrow). e. Summary of fluorescence changes in Gr66a cells without (grey) or with ppk28 (green) tested with water, 0.5 and 1M NMDG and 0.5, 1 and 2M sucrose. (n=4-5 trials/concentration ± s.e.m; t-test, versus Gr66a control, water: **P=0.013, 0.5M NMDG: *P=0.03; water: **P=0.002, 0.5M sucrose: ***P=0.0002).
